Ticket: Nightly reindex blocked — Harrowfen search vault locked

The nightly search reindex job cannot read stopword dictionaries because the Harrowfen credentials vault auto-locked after three failed token refreshes. Future maintainers: do not delete the vault file; the index mappings inside are not reproducible. Unlock it via the recovery CLI, which prompts for the maintainer recovery passphrase recorded below.

unlock words, faweg-fahop: wendor-kelmir-ulaeth-holael

MEMO — Training Budget FY Next

Sales leads: next year's training budget is set at 80% of this year's. Priorities: Fenwright certification for all senior reps, negotiation refreshers for new hires, nothing else without sign-off. Submit your team plans by end of month. External conferences are out except the Calderholt summit, two seats per region. No exceptions will be entertained after the deadline. Budget rationale ties into wider plans, summarised in the restricted note below.

internal memo for fajog-yagaf: Gross margin on Ulaael came in at 20 percent against a plan of 10 percent. Only 9 of the 80 pilot accounts renewed Ulaael, so a churn review is set for July 1.

## Account Recovery — Trailnote Offline Mode

When a surveyor's Trailnote app has been offline for 30+ days, their local credentials expire and sync refuses to resume. Don't make them wipe the device — all their unsynced field data lives there! Instead, open the support console, pick "Offline Reinstate," and enter their handle. The console will ask for the support team's shared recovery passphrase before issuing a reinstatement token. Use the one below.

unlock words, bagaf-fajeg: zorael-kelax-fraath-quenix-eliok-sileth-aldmir-wenir-druiel

**Service Accounts — Payroll Export**

The Fernpost payroll export switched from fixed-width to delimited format last sprint. The `payroll-export` service account now calls the Quillgate formatter instead of writing files directly. If exports fail on-call: check formatter health first, then the account's token age. Rotation is quarterly, no exceptions. Do not reuse the old fixed-width pipeline creds. Current key for the formatter endpoint follows.

API key for tagef-fafop: vxb2-ta